Aims & Scope
Logos & Littera is an open access international peer-reviewed journal whose aim is to publish original research in linguistics, translation studies, LSP, terminology and literature. It aims to provide a platform for interdisciplinary approaches to texts, understood broadly, while encouraging sound empirical and conceptual research.

Frequently asked questions about Logos et Littera: Interdisciplinary Approaches to Text
Is Logos et Littera: Interdisciplinary Approaches to Text a predatory journal?
PubScope has no integrity flags on record for Logos et Littera: Interdisciplinary Approaches to Text: it is indexed in DOAJ, and is not on DOAJ's withdrawn list. Its PubScope Trust Score is 52/100. Indexing is a transparency signal, not a guarantee β always confirm fit and policies before submitting.
What is the impact factor of Logos et Littera: Interdisciplinary Approaches to Text?
Logos et Littera: Interdisciplinary Approaches to Text is not in the Web of Science Core Collection, so it has no official Clarivate Journal Impact Factor.
Is Logos et Littera: Interdisciplinary Approaches to Text indexed in Scopus and Web of Science?
Logos et Littera: Interdisciplinary Approaches to Text is indexed in DOAJ.
